Presentation of Hamina development ideas on Monday, August 10, 2026

During the Hamina Tattoo event week, master's students in regional planning at the German TU Dortmund University interviewed both residents and event guests to gather ideas for the development of Hamina. Based on these, the students prepared proposals for the development of the Hamina master plan as their coursework.

The focus of the work is on improving the tourism infrastructure, focusing in particular on the city centre and Tervasaari areas. The plans emphasize the opportunities for sports, cultural and wellbeing tourism. The starting point of the planning is a participatory approach, taking into account the views and needs of both Hamina residents and tourists.

On Monday, August 10, 2026, from 2-3:30 p.m., students will present their development proposals in English in the council chamber of Hamina Town Hall..
